First details of Bonhams Aston Martin Sale at Newport Pagnell 2003

Bonhams is licensed to thrill collectors of Aston Martin motor cars and world-wide fans of James Bond movies this spring by offering for sale the V12 Vanquish, driven by Pierce Brosnan and featured in the latest blockbuster Die Another Day. The car will be sold at Newport Pagnell on 10 May 2003.

Chassis no. SCFAC13372B500172 is one of just three pristine 'hero' cars, driven by Brosnan on location in Iceland, and the only one for sale. The car is featured extensively in close-up shots of British secret agent 007 in pursuit of villain Gustav Graves.

The specially coloured 'Tungsten Silver' Vanquish cuts a striking image as the two play cat and mouse across the frozen landscape, while the dashing Bond tries to save the world from Graves' solar powered satellite weapon. Despite being driven by one maverick owner in the film, the car is in perfect condition. It has all the specifications one would normally expect to find on a brand new Vanquish and it will be offered with a letter of authenticity from Aston Martin, confirming that the car was driven by Pierce Brosnan on the set of Die Another Day.

Bonhams' sale, which is held annually at Aston Martin's Newport Pagnell Works Service, will include around 50 of the finest Aston Martin's available, in addition to 150 lots of automobilia, and - for the first time - a James Bond memorabilia section will be incorporated into this special event.
